Inns in Denmark
The cosiest way of getting to know Denmark
Inns in Denmark With a history dating back to the 12th century, the Danish country inns were the staging posts where the coaches stopped to allow weary wayfarers to stretch their legs and enjoy a hearty meal. Their traditional monopoly as distillers and their sole licence to serve beer played a decisive role in shaping the Danish way of life.
